Story summary
- Focus Features is negotiating to acquire U.S. rights for the horror film "Obsession" at the Toronto Film Festival.
- The deal is projected to exceed $15 million, marking the festival's first significant acquisition.
- "Obsession" is Curry Barker's directorial debut, following his successful YouTube short "Milk & Serial."
- The film premiered at Midnight Madness, starring Michael Johnston and Inde Navarrette.
- Critics commend Navarrette's performance and Barker's effective blend of horror and comedy.
